Syntax: connection-settings timeout default <service> <timeout>
Replace <service> with a default service. Available default services are listed
in Table A-19.
Replace <timeout> with the number of seconds that you want an inactive
session to remain open.
For example, to set the default TCP session timeout to 100 seconds, enter the
following command:
ProCurve(tms-module-<slot ID>:config)# connection-
settings timeout default tcp 100
To create (or delete) a custom service and timeout, enter the following
command:
Syntax: [no] connection-settings timeout <service> < tcp | udp > <port number>
<timeout>
Replace <service> with a custom service name.
Replace <port number> with the TCP or UDP port for the service.
Replace <timeout> with the number of seconds that you want an inactive
session to remain open.
For example, to create a custom timeout called h323inac which runs over TCP
through port 1720 and times out after 45 seconds of inactivity, enter the
following command:
ProCurve(tms-module-<slot ID>:config)# connection-
settings timeout h323inac tcp 1720 45
connection-settings reservation
This command reserves firewall associations for specific addresses or address
ranges which may need priority access to some resources. The reservation
ensures that these resources are always available for these devices. If associ-
ations are not available, the firewall will drop traffic from a device without a
reservation and establish a connection for the device with a reservation.
